A Mother’s Mission 9 - The power words can have

Want to know something you should never do? Talk about your children’s flaws to others. I’ve seen this happen before, the mother isn’t happy with her child’s behavior and so when someone is visiting their home, she’ll start talking about all the bad things her daughter or son does, they do this with the intention that she or he will feel ashamed and change her attitude, but just the opposite tends to occur.

This is how the conversation went along as the mother vented to the guest in her home:

“ She’s lazy, she doesn’t want to help me in anything, she wakes up late, her room is a mess, she is nothing like her sister, I don’t even know who she came out like….”

And with that said, she ended up saying to her daughter:

“Nobody is going to want to marry you the way you are, you’re going to be all alone, the first boyfriend you have I’m going to tell him everything, and when he finds out, he’s going to run…”

Be careful with your words, which make all the difference, as a mother your words have power in the life of your children, that’s why you should never curse them with your words, use the power of your words instead to bless them, and confess good things for them and their future.

Sometimes, in the moment of your fury you say many things and soon after you regret it, but remember after you’ve already said the words there is no way to take them back.

Watch your words and control your anxiety to say things you don’t mean, your child’s future is greatly measured by what you determine for their lives.

Out of the same mouth proceedeth blessing and cursing. My brethren, these things ought not so to be. Doth a fountain send forth at the same place sweet water and bitter?” James 3:10,11
